*{ margin:0; padding:0;}
html {overflow-x:hidden;overflow-y:auto;}
body { background:url(/image/web_bg.png) repeat-x 0 0 #fff ;font-family:Arial, Helvetica, sans-serif; font-size:12px;color:#666}
a:link,a:visited,a:active{ color:#000; text-decoration:none; font-size:12px;star:expression(this.onFocus=this.blur());}
a:hover{ color:#f00; text-decoration:underline;font-size:12px;}
a:focus {outline:0;}
ul,dl,li,dd,dl { list-style:none;}
img { border:none;}
span,em,i,u { font-style:normal; font-family:Arial, Helvetica, sans-serif; text-decoration:none;}
li a { font-family:Arial, Helvetica, sans-serif}
li { font-family:"宋体"}
.gehang { width:5px; height:5px; overflow:hidden; clear:both;}
.show { overflow:hidden}
.none { display:none}

.list_12 {}
	.list_12 li { height:24px; line-height:24px; overflow:hidden; color:#f60;}
	.list_12 li span { float:right; padding:0 0 0 10px; color:#999}
	.list_12 li em { color:#f00; font-family:"宋体"}
	.list_12 li em a { color:#f00}

.list_14 {}
	.list_14 li { height:28px; line-height:28px; overflow:hidden; color:#f60}
		#web .list_14 li a { font-size:14px;}
	.list_14 li span { float:right; padding:0 0 0 10px; color:#999}
	.list_14 li u { text-decoration:none; font-size:12px; color:#1E50A2; padding:0 5px 0 0;}
		#web .list_14 li u a { font-size:12px; color:#1E50A2}

#web { width:1060px; overflow:hidden; margin:0 auto;}

/*Logo*/
#head { width:1060px; height:90px; overflow:hidden; background:url(/image/head_bg.png) no-repeat right 0;}
	#logo { background:url(/image/logo.png) no-repeat 0 0; height:90px; width:230px; float:left;}
		#logo a { display:block; width:230px; height:90px; text-indent:-999em;}
	#head_link { float:right; padding:10px 0 0;}
		#head_link a { width:73px; float:left; display:block;}
	#head_tel { display:none;}

/*菜单*/
#nav { width:826px; height:30px; overflow:hidden; no-repeat 0 0; float:inherit; padding-top:60px;} 
	#chromemenu { width:826px; overflow:hidden; padding-left:1px;}
	#chromemenu ul { width:828px; overflow:hidden}
	#chromemenu li { float:left; width:110px; height:39px; text-align:bottom; line-height:39px; background:url(/image/nav_line.png) no-repeat right bottom; color:#FFF;}
		#chromemenu li a { font-size:14px; font-weight:bold; display:block;width:110px; height:39px; color:#FFF;}
		#chromemenu li a:hover { background:url(/image/nav_on.png) no-repeat center; color:#000; text-decoration:none;}
    #chromemenu .MenuText { width:100%; border-radius:10px; -moz-border-radius:10px; background:#575757; float:left; text-align:center ;}
    #chromemenu .MenuText:hover {background:#FF6; color:#000;}
	
.ebox { padding:1px; background:#fff; border:1px solid #ccc;}
	#where,.ebox_title { height:25px; border-bottom:1px solid #fff; background:url(/image/ebox.png) no-repeat 0 0;}
	#where h3,.ebox_title h3 { padding:0 0 0 40px; font-size:14px; line-height:25px; color:#234983;}
	.ebox_title a { float:right; background:url(/image/ebox_more.png) no-repeat 0 5px; width:43px; height:13px; display:block; text-indent:-999em; padding:5px 10px 0 0}
	#where span { float:right; line-height:25px; padding:0 10px 0 0;}
	.ebox_con { background:#eee;}

/*主体*/
#main { width:1060px; overflow:hidden;}
	#main_left { width:230px; float:left;}
		#gonggao { width:206px; padding:10px; height:100px;}
			#gonggao marquee { display:block; width:206px; height:100px; text-indent:2em; line-height:24px;}
			
		#pro_class { width:206px; padding:10px;}
			#pro_class ul {border-bottom:1px solid #fff;}
			#pro_class li { height:26px; border-bottom:1px solid #ccc; border-top:1px solid #fff; line-height:26px; background:url(/image/do.png) no-repeat 20px 8px; text-indent:32px;}
			#pro_class h3 { height:26px; border-bottom:1px solid #ccc; border-top:1px solid #fff; line-height:26px; text-indent:15px; color:#FFF;}
			#pro_class h3 img  { width:20px; height:20px; padding-top:3px;padding-right:3px;}
			
			#pro_class .pro_list_a { border-top:none;}
			
		#soso { background:url(/image/soso_bg.png) no-repeat 0 0; width:177px; height:25px; padding:5px 0 0 53px;}
			#soso #homesearch{ display:block; float:left; width:130px; border:none; background:none; height:18px; line-height:18px;}
			#soso .inputButton { display:block; width:38px; height:17px; border:none; background:none; text-indent:-999em; cursor:pointer}
		#lianxi { width:206px; padding:10px; height:168px; line-height:24px;}
		
		
	#main_right { width:829px;  float:right;}
			#main_about { width:406px; float:left; overflow:hidden}
			#main_about .ebox_con { width:386px; padding:5px 10px; line-height:24px; text-indent:2em;}
			#main_about .ebox_con img { float:right; margin:0 0 0 10px;}
		#main_news { width:414px; float:right}
			.tab_block { display:block}
			.tab_none { display:none;}
			#tab_1 img { height:236px; width:400px;}
			
				.navtab {height:25px; border-bottom:1px solid #fff; background:url(/image/ebox.png) no-repeat 0 0;}
				.navtab ul { padding:0 0 0 23px;}
				.navtab li { float:left; width:90px; background:url(/image/ebox.png) no-repeat -23px 0; height:25px; line-height:25px; text-indent:15px;}
				#web .navtab li a { font-size:14px;color:#234983; letter-spacing:1px;}
				#web li.active a { font-weight:bold; text-decoration:none; letter-spacing:0;}
				#web .navtab h3 { padding-left:40px; padding-top:3px;}
			#main_news .ebox_con { width:400px; padding:5px 10px 5px 5px;}
			
		#main_pro { width:825px; overflow:hidden}
		#pro #main_pro { width:829px; overflow:hidden}
		#main_pro .ebox {width:825px; overflow:hidden}
			#main_pro .ebox_con { width:825px; height:130px; overflow:hidden; padding:5px 5px 0; *padding:5px;}
				#main_pro .ebox_con ul { width:825px; overflow:hidden}
				#main_pro .ebox_con li { float:left; width:130px; margin:0 0px 5px 5px;}
					#main_pro .ebox_con li a { display:block; width:120px; overflow:hidden; margin:0 auto; padding:3px; border:1px solid #ccc; background:#fff; text-decoration:none; color:#000; cursor:pointer}
					#main_pro .ebox_con li a:hover { border:1px solid #f60;}
					#main_pro .ebox_con li a img { width:120px; height:100px;}
					#main_pro .ebox_con li a span { height:28px; line-height:28px; text-align:center; overflow:hidden; display:block; font-size:14px;color:#234983;}
					#main_pro .ebox_con li a u { text-align:center; display:block;}
					#main_pro .ebox_con li a u em { font-size:16px; font-family:Georgia, "Times New Roman", Times, serif; color:#f60;}
										

			#Fenye .ebox_con { width:825px;  overflow:hidden; padding:5px 5px 0; *padding:5px;}
					
					
		#soso_fenye {width:716px; overflow:hidden}
			#soso_fenye .ebox_con { width:696px; overflow:hidden; padding:10px 10px 0; *padding:10px;}
			#soso_fenye .ebox_con li { height:28px; line-height:28px; overflow:hidden; color:#f60;}
				#soso_fenye .ebox_con li em { float:right; color:#999;}
				#soso_fenye .ebox_con li a { font-size:14px;}
				#soso_fenye .ebox_con li u { font-family:"宋体"; color:#234983;}
				#soso_fenye .ebox_con li u a {color:#234983; font-size:12px;}

/*页脚*/

#footer{ background:#575757;height:145px; width:100%; margin-top:5px;}
#footer .titler{ border-bottom:1px solid #4a4a4a;height:30px; width:100%;}
#footer .titler .title{width:1060px; height:30px; margin:0 auto;}
#footer .titler .title .title1{ height:25px;width:70px; font-size:14px; font-weight:bold; color:#FFFFFF; padding-top:2px; margin-left:5px; float:left;}
#footer .titler .title .title2{ width:500px;height:25px; margin-right:15px; margin-bottom:0px;}
#footer .titler .title .title2 ul{}
#footer .titler .title .title2 li{ float:left; width:80px; padding-top:10px;padding-left:10px;}
#footer .titler .title .title2 li a{ font-size:12px; color:#FFFFFF;}

#footer .copyright{border-top:1px solid #686868;}
#footer .copyright .copy{width:1060px; margin:0 auto;height:95px;}
#footer .copyright .copy ul.part1{ width:200px; height:90px; margin-top:2px; border-right:1px solid #4a4a4a; float:left; padding:0px 0px;}
#footer .copyright .copy ul.part1 li{ width:50%;height:20px; float:left; line-height:20px; padding-left:5px; color:#FFF;}
#footer .copyright .copy ul.part1 li a{ font-size:14px; color:#FFFFFF; line-height:20px;}
#footer .copyright .copy ul.part2{ width:254px; height:90px; margin-top:2px; border-left: 1px solid #686868; float:right;}
#footer .copyright .copy ul.part2 li{ padding-left:20px; line-height:20px;}
#footer .copyright .copy ul.part2 li a{font-size:14px; color:#FFFFFF}

#fenye_list { padding:10px 10px 10px 5px; width:701px; overflow:hidden}
	#fenye_list ul { padding:5px 0;}

/*文章分页样式*/
#fenye{clear:both;}
#fenye a{text-decoration:none;}
#fenye .prev,#fenye .next{width:52px; text-align:center;}
#fenye a.curr{width:22px;background:#1f3a87; border:1px solid #1f3a87; color:#fff; font-weight:bold; text-align:center;}
#fenye a.curr font { color:#fff}
#fenye a.curr:visited {color:#fff;}
#fenye a{margin:5px 4px 0 0; color:#1E50A2;background:#fff; display:inline-table; border:1px solid #dcdddd; float:left; text-align:center;height:22px;line-height:22px}
#fenye a.num{width:22px;}
#fenye a:visited{color:#1f3a87;} 
#fenye a:hover{color:#fff; background:#1E50A2; border:1px solid #1E50A2;float:left;}
#fenye span{ display:none}
#fenye img{ width:80%}

/* 布局 - 文章阅读页面 */
#article { width:696px; overflow:hidden; clear:both; padding:0 10px;}
#article_title{ font-size:20px; text-align:center; color:#f50; font-weight:bold; line-height:50px; font-family:"微软雅黑","黑体"}
#line { background:#fff; height:1px; clear:both; overflow:hidden;}
#article_date{ height:30px; line-height:30px;text-align:center; border-top:1px dashed #dddddd;}
#article_shoucang img {  padding:0 4px;}
#article_info{ text-indent:2em; line-height:20px; padding:5px; border:1px dashed #B8CDE3; background:#F8FBFC; color:#0456A0}
#article_nr { font-size:14px; line-height:2em; color:#222; width:696px; overflow:hidden;text-indent:2em;}
	#article_nr #MyContent p { padding:5px 0;text-indent:2em;}
	#article_nr #MyContent img {width: expression(this.width > 600 ? 600: true); max-width: 600px;padding:4px;border:1px solid #D4E2E3;text-align:center; display:block; margin:5px auto;}
	#article_nr #MyContent a:link,#article_nr #MyContent a:visited,#article_nr #MyContent a:active{color:#f60;font-size:14px; } 
	#article_nr #MyContent a:hover{color:#50AC23;font-size:14px;} 
	#article_nr #MyContent h1,
	#article_nr #MyContent h2,
	#article_nr #MyContent h3,
	#article_nr #MyContent h4,
	#article_nr #MyContent h5,
	#article_nr #MyContent h6 { color:#000;font-family:"宋体"; border-bottom:1px solid #ACCEDD; border-top:3px solid #ACCEDD; background:#F7F7F7; text-indent:24px; line-height:1.5em; margin:10px 0;}
	#article_nr #MyContent emBED {width:510px; height:420px; display:block; margin:10px auto;}
	#article_nr #MyContent table,#pro_table table {width:100%;border-bottom:none; border-right:none; border-left:1px solid #D4E2E3;border-top:1px solid #D4E2E3; text-indent:0; font-size:12px;}
	#article_nr #MyContent table th,#pro_table table th { color:#fff; border-bottom:1px solid #D4E2E3; border-right:1px solid #D4E2E3;padding:0 8px; background:#4A71B0;font-size:14px;}
	#article_nr #MyContent table td ,#pro_table table td{border-bottom:1px solid #D4E2E3; border-right:1px solid #D4E2E3;padding:0 8px;}
	#article_nr #MyContent table h1,
	#article_nr #MyContent table h2,
	#article_nr #MyContent table h3,
	#article_nr #MyContent table h4,
	#article_nr #MyContent table h5,
	#article_nr #MyContent table h6 { line-height:150%; overflow:hidden; font-size:12px; background:none; border:none;}
	#article_nr #MyContent table tr:hover { background:#fff;}
	#article_nr #MyContent table tr td:hover ,,#pro_table table tr td:hover{ background:#F5F8FA;}
	#article_nr #MyContent table img {display:inline; border:none}
	#article_nr #MyContent p table { position:relative;left:-24px;*left:0}
	#article_nr #MyContent h1 {font-size:24px;}
	#article_nr #MyContent h2 {font-size:22px;}
	#article_nr #MyContent h3 {font-size:18px;}
	#article_nr #MyContent h4 {font-size:16px;}
	#article_nr #MyContent h5 {font-size:14px;}
	#article_nr #MyContent h6 {font-size:14px;}
	#article_nr #MyContent h1 a:link,#article_nr #MyContent h1 a:visited,#article_nr #MyContent h1 a:active,#article_nr #MyContent h1 a:hover{font-size:24px;color:red;}
	#article_nr #MyContent h2 a:link,#article_nr #MyContent h2 a:visited,#article_nr #MyContent h2 a:active,#article_nr #MyContent h2 a:hover{font-size:22px;color:red;}
	#article_nr #MyContent h3 a:link,#article_nr #MyContent h3 a:visited,#article_nr #MyContent h3 a:active,#article_nr #MyContent h3 a:hover{font-size:18px;color:red;}
	#article_nr #MyContent h4 a:link,#article_nr #MyContent h4 a:visited,#article_nr #MyContent h4 a:active,#article_nr #MyContent h4 a:hover{font-size:16px;color:red;}
	#article_nr #MyContent h5 a:link,#article_nr #MyContent h5 a:visited,#article_nr #MyContent h5 a:active,#article_nr #MyContent h5 a:hover{font-size:14px;color:red;}
	#article_nr #MyContent h6 a:link,#article_nr #MyContent h6 a:visited,#article_nr #MyContent h6 a:active,#article_nr #MyContent h6 a:hover{font-size:14px;color:red;}
#article_sc { float:left; padding:5px 0 0}
#article_next{ clear:both; line-height:24px; border-top:1px dashed #ccc; padding:5px 0;}

#pro_table { line-height:2em;}

#guestbook { width:716px; overflow:hidden;}
#GuestList {width:690px; margin:0 auto; clear:both; padding:10px 13px 0;} 

#club_link { width:690px; overflow:hidden; height:38px;} 
  #club_link a { display:block; width:110px; float:right; height:30px; background-image:url(/image/club_linl.png); text-indent:-999em; padding:0 10px 0 0; background-repeat:no-repeat} 
  #club_link .a { background-position:0 -30px;} 
#Content { width:550px; height:200px; } 
.club_list{ width:690px; overflow:hidden; border-top:1px solid #B9D8F9; clear:both; margin:0 0 10px;background:#fff} 
.club_left { width:120px; float:left; height:120px; background:#E8F2FD} 
  .club_123 { font-family:"Arial Black", Gadget, sans-serif; font-size:60px; display:block; width:120px; height:90px; text-align:center; color:#1074D8} 
  .club_name { width:120px; display:block; height:30px; text-align:center; font-weight:bold; color:#f60;} 
.club_right { width:560px; float:right} 
  .club_top { height:30px; line-height:30px; overflow:hidden; width:560px; border-bottom:1px solid #B9D8F9} 
   .club_title { float:left; font-size:14px; color:#f60;} 
  .club_con { line-height:22px; color:#666; text-indent:2em; padding:5px 0;} 
  .club_date { height:30px; line-height:30px; text-align:right; color:#1074D8; float:right} 
  .club_huifu { width:538px; background:#f7fbff; padding:10px; border:1px dashed #B9D8F9; float:right} 
   .club_huifu_title { font-size:14px; color:#f00;} 
   .club_huifu_con { line-height:22px; color:#666; text-indent:2em; padding:5px 0;} 
   .club_huifu_date { height:20px; line-height:20px; color:#1074D8; float:right}

